Abstract

Official abstract text for this publication.

A plastic filler for a cylinder conveyor, wherein the cylindrical conveyor includes a drum supported on a central shaft and defines a void therebetween, and wherein the plastic filler at least partially fills the void and thereby prevents the entry of contaminants into the void.

The invention claimed is: 1. A plastic filler for a cylindrical conveyor comprising an elongate central shaft, a plurality of radial supports supported on the shaft in a spaced apart relation along the shaft, and a drum supported on the supports in positions that are coaxial with the central shaft, the plastic filler comprising: a cylindrical outer surface to be positioned immediately adjacent to an inner surface of the drum; an inner surface to be positioned adjacent to and surrounding the central shaft; a first end to be positioned adjacent to a first one of the plurality of radial supports; and a second end to be positioned adjacent to a second one of the plurality of radial supports, such that the plastic filler fills a void and excludes contaminants from between the central shaft and the drum, wherein the plastic filler comprises two or more thermoplastic bodies in an abutting relationship about an axis along which the elongate central shaft is to extend through the plastic filler, each of the bodies extending less than 360° about the axis, wherein the two or more thermoplastic bodies collectively extend 360° about the axis and define the cylindrical outer surface. 2. The plastic filler of claim 1 , wherein the two or more thermoplastic bodies comprise a thermoplastic body having an integral polymeric wall completely surrounding and enclosing a hollow interior, the integral polymeric wall forming a portion of the cylindrical outer surface. 3. The plastic filler of claim 2 , wherein the hollow interior is empty, being filled with air. 4. The plastic filler of claim 1 , wherein the plastic filler defines a generally cylindrical outer surface that is closely spaced to an inner surface of the drum over substantially an entire length of the plastic filler, and a cylindrical inner surface that extends around and is closely spaced to the central shaft over substantially an entire length of the central shaft. 5. The plastic filler of claim 1 , wherein the two or more thermoplastic bodies comprise two thermoplastic bodies that are fixed to each other with at least one fastener. 6. The plastic filler of claim 5 , wherein the two thermoplastic bodies each comprise an aperture projecting into the cylindrical outer surface and receiving the at least one fastener. 7. The plastic filler of claim 1 , wherein the two or more thermoplastic bodies comprise two semi cylindrical polymeric bodies, the semi cylindrical polymeric bodies being joined along an interface extending in a plane to contain the axis. 8. The plastic filler of claim 1 , wherein the first end comprises a cylindrical recess having a face facing in a direction parallel to the axis away from an axial center of the plastic filler. 9. A cylindrical conveyor comprising: an elongate central shaft; a plurality of radial supports supported on the shaft in a spaced apart relation along the longitudinal length of the shaft; a drum supported on the supports in a position that are coaxial with the central shaft and a plastic filler comprising an outer surface that is generally cylindrical and immediately adjacent to an inner surface of the drum; an inner surface adjacent to and surrounding the central shaft; a first end adjacent to a first one of the plurality of radial supports; and a second end adjacent to a second one of the plurality of radial supports, wherein whereby the plastic filler thereby fills a void and excludes contaminants from between the central shaft and the drum, wherein the drum comprises one or more individual cylinder segments that are removable from the cylindrical conveyor to thereby provide an opening in the drum, and further wherein the plastic filler is sized for insertion into cylindrical conveyor through the opening in the drum. 10. The plastic filler of claim 9 , wherein the plastic filler comprises two hollow bodies that can be inserted individually and sequentially into the cylindrical conveyor through the opening. 11. The plastic filler of claim 10 , where the two hollow bodies can be fixed to each other with fasteners once they are inserted into the drum. 12. A cylindrical conveyor comprising: an elongate central shaft; a plurality of radial supports supported on the shaft in a spaced apart relation along the longitudinal length of the shaft; a drum supported on the supports in a position that are coaxial with the central shaft, wherein the drum comprises outwardly projecting crop-engaging protuberances; and a plastic filler comprising: an outer surface that is generally cylindrical and immediately adjacent to an inner surface of the drum; an inner surface adjacent to and surrounding the central shaft; a first end adjacent to a first one of the plurality of radial supports; and a second end adjacent to a second one of the plurality of radial supports, wherein the plastic filler fills a void and excludes contaminants from between the central shaft and the drum. 13. An agricultural combine comprising a chassis supported on at least one wheel, a feederhouse supported on the chassis, and configured to convey cut crop material from an agricultural harvesting head to a threshing, separating, and cleaning mechanism, and at least one cylindrical conveyor supported on the chassis in accordance with claim 12 . 14.
